I See in Logs a Lot of Blocked Messages with Reason: "Forbidden. Please Enable JavaScript. Spam Sender Name."
What does the response *** Forbidden. Please enable JavaScript. *** mean?
A lot of spam bots can't perform JavaScript code, so it is one of the important checks and most of the spam bots will be blocked with reason "Forbidden. Please enable JavaScript. Spam sender name." All browsers can perform JS code, so real visitors won't be blocked.
